Text Information:The Latin text here, for which the musical setting was originally composed, is from Psalm 100:1. The English paraphrase gives this verse a Christian interpretation, much as Isaac Watts did when he paraphrased Psalm 98 to produce “Joy to the World! The Lord Is Come” (see no. 134).
